In our ongoing efforts to better represent the DJ community to other event professionals that can & do influence the entertainment potential clients might choose, we felt it important to provide NACE members with a more accurate assessment of what we do, how we do it & how the actions of the DJ ultimately reflect upon the venue. We started last year with providing them a seminar speaker to their conference. This year we are doing so much more!
During this conference the ADJA will be supplying all the DJ talent as well as MC’s, group discussion leaders, & ambassadors of hospitality for our industry. The level of participationextended to us is unprecedented. No other business partner has been given such broad exposure & opportunities to show what they can do. This is our time to shine.
